Good job :smiley: I also have SW127MAK, that I bought as my first scope, I bought the Revelation photo-visual eyepiece and filter kit for mine as I was a beginner and didn't want to spend a lot so early on. Its got good reviews and around 130 quid ish you can't complain. google it and check it out. Other photo-visual eyepiece and filter kits are available :smiley: I've now started on the TV EP slippery slope.
